Postgraduate Certificate in Sustainable Practices for Land Management

The Postgraduate Certificate in Sustainable Practices for Land Management equips professionals with the skills to address environmental challenges and promote sustainable land use. Designed for land managers, policymakers, and environmental specialists, this program focuses on innovative strategies for balancing ecological health with economic and social needs.


Through practical coursework and expert-led insights, learners gain expertise in resource conservation, climate resilience, and regenerative practices. This certificate is ideal for those seeking to drive positive change in land stewardship and sustainability.

Career Path

Sustainability Consultant: Advises businesses on implementing eco-friendly practices to reduce environmental impact and improve efficiency.

Land Management Specialist: Focuses on sustainable land use, conservation, and resource management to balance ecological and economic needs.

Environmental Policy Advisor: Develops and advocates for policies that promote sustainable practices and environmental protection.

Conservation Project Manager: Oversees projects aimed at preserving natural habitats and biodiversity while ensuring community engagement.

Renewable Energy Analyst: Evaluates and promotes renewable energy solutions to support sustainable land management practices.
